Address 0 DCR

DsRMutP29bG7z5yk4t8fzxHiHnsT4SQvZaU

Confirmed

Total Received0.16368586 DCR
Total Sent0.16368586 DCR
Final Balance0 DCR
No. Transactions2

Transactions